Synopsis

A high school senior gets an unwanted front row seat to the most absurd—and explosive—epidemic as it races across her New Jersey high school in this "wildly inventive" (Entertainment Weekly) coming-of-age dark comedy.

“Truly the smartest and funniest book about spontaneous combustion you will ever read.”—John Green, #1 bestselling author of The Fault in Our Stars

“A blood-soaked, laugh-filled, tear-drenched, endlessly compelling read.”—Kirkus Reviews, starred review

Mara Carlyle’s senior year is going as normally as could be expected until—wa bam!—fellow senior Katelyn Ogden explodes during third period pre-calc.

Katelyn is the first, but she won’t be the last senior to blow up without warning or explanation. With the whole country watching, the FBI soon rolls into Mara’s suburban New Jersey hometown and the search is on for answers.

Whip-smart and blunt, Mara narrates the end of their world as she knows it while trying to make it to graduation in one piece. It’s an explosive year punctuated by romance, quarantine, lifelong friendship, hallucinogenic mushrooms, bloggers, ice-cream trucks, “Snooze Button™,” Bon Jovi, and the filthiest language you’ve ever heard from the president of the United States.

In Spontaneous, every rule is defied, but beneath the outrageous is a super honest and truly moving exemplar of the absurd and raw truths of being a teenager in the twenty-first century—and the heartache of saying good-bye.

The inspiration for the motion picture starring Katherine Langford, Charlie Plummer, and Hayley Law!

About The Author

Aaron Starmer is the author of numerous novels for young readers, including The Only Ones and The Riverman. He lives in Vermont with his wife and daughter.You can find Aaron online at @AaronStarmer.
